Recipe: Bread machine bagels

I got a bread machine last year. My normal weekend breakfast during the summer is bagels, so I figured I needed to make my own. These turn out nicely, once you figure out that the hole needs to be a lot bigger than you would think.

Ingredients:
1 1/4 cup water
3 3/4 cup flour
2 tbsp sugar
1 tsp salt
1 1/2 tsp yeast

Fill machine as per normal bread and run dough cycle.

Remove and let rest 10-15 min.

Cut dough into 8-10 pieces, roll into balls.

Flatten and shape by putting a hole in the middle. Stretch so it’s pretty big.

Cover with a towel and rest 10 mins.

Put 3 quarts of water in a large pot, bring to medium boil. Add 3 tbsp of sugar.

Boil each for 30 secs each side.

Drain on a wire rack.

Mix an egg white with 1 tbsp of water.

Wash boiled bagels with egg mix, top with what ever you like (bagel mix, salt, etc.)

Preheat oven to 375.

Sprinkle baking sheet with corn meal, place bagels.

Bake for 20-25 mins.

Recipe: Mulligatawny soup

Just found this-yummy. Brings back memories of London and delicious soups. And it’s very close to that.

Ingredients:
3 Tbsp. unsalted butter
2 medium onions, finely chopped
1 large carrot, finely chopped
1 celery stalk, finely chopped
1 red serrano, finely chopped
Kosher salt
1/4 tsp. freshly ground black pepper
4 cloves garlic
1 Tbsp. fresh ginger, minced
1 Tbsp. curry powder
1 tsp. ground cumin
1 tsp. ground coriander
1 tsp. turmeric
1/4 tsp. cayenne pepper
1 Granny Smith apple, peeled, cored, and finely chopped
1 1/2 cups split red lentils
6 cups low-sodium vegetable stock
2 bay leaves
1 (14.5-oz.) can chickpeas, drained and rinsed
1/2 cup plain yogurt
Juice from half a lemon

In a large Dutch oven over medium-high heat, melt butter until it stops foaming, Add onions, carrot, celery, and red chile, and season with ½ tsp of salt and ¼ teaspoon pepper. Cook for about 6 to 7 minutes, or until onions are translucent and the vegetables are starting to brown lightly on the edges.

Add garlic and ginger and cook, stirring constantly, for 1 minute. Stir in spices and ½ teaspoon salt and cook for another 30 seconds. Reduce heat to medium and stir in apple until completely coated.

Rinse lentils in a fine mesh strainer and shake off excess water. Stir in lentils, vegetable stock, and bay leaves. Increase heat to medium high and bring to a boil, then reduce to a simmer and cook, covered, for 30 minutes.

Add chickpeas and 2 ½ tsp of salt, and simmer, covered, for 15 minutes or until chickpeas are heated through and completely tender.

Combine yogurt and lemon juice in a small bowl. Temper the yogurt with some of the soup. When chickpeas are done simmering, stir in yogurt mixture a little at a time until no more streaks of white remain.
